|  | #include <linux/init.h> | 
|  | #include <linux/mm.h> | 
|  | #include <linux/bootmem.h> | 
|  | #include <linux/pfn.h> | 
|  |  | 
|  | #include <asm/bootinfo.h> | 
|  | #include <asm/page.h> | 
|  | #include <asm/sections.h> | 
|  |  | 
|  | #include <asm/mips-boards/prom.h> | 
|  |  | 
|  | /*#define DEBUG*/ | 
|  |  | 
|  | enum simmem_memtypes { | 
|  | simmem_reserved = 0, | 
|  | simmem_free, | 
|  | }; | 
|  | struct prom_pmemblock mdesc[PROM_MAX_PMEMBLOCKS]; | 
|  |  | 
|  | #ifdef DEBUG | 
|  | static char *mtypes[3] = { | 
|  | "SIM reserved memory", | 
|  | "SIM free memory", | 
|  | }; | 
|  | #endif | 
|  |  | 
|  | struct prom_pmemblock * __init prom_getmdesc(void) | 
|  | { | 
|  | unsigned int memsize; | 
|  |  | 
|  | memsize = 0x02000000; | 
|  | pr_info("Setting default memory size 0x%08x\n", memsize); | 
|  |  | 
|  | memset(mdesc, 0, sizeof(mdesc)); | 
|  |  | 
|  | mdesc[0].type = simmem_reserved; | 
|  | mdesc[0].base = 0x00000000; | 
|  | mdesc[0].size = 0x00001000; | 
|  |  | 
|  | mdesc[1].type = simmem_free; | 
|  | mdesc[1].base = 0x00001000; | 
|  | mdesc[1].size = 0x000ff000; | 
|  |  | 
|  | mdesc[2].type = simmem_reserved; | 
|  | mdesc[2].base = 0x00100000; | 
|  | mdesc[2].size = CPHYSADDR(PFN_ALIGN(&_end)) - mdesc[2].base; | 
|  |  | 
|  | mdesc[3].type = simmem_free; | 
|  | mdesc[3].base = CPHYSADDR(PFN_ALIGN(&_end)); | 
|  | mdesc[3].size = memsize - mdesc[3].base; | 
|  |  | 
|  | return &mdesc[0]; | 
|  | } | 
|  |  | 
|  | static int __init prom_memtype_classify (unsigned int type) | 
|  | { | 
|  | switch (type) { | 
|  | case simmem_free: | 
|  | return BOOT_MEM_RAM; | 
|  | case simmem_reserved: | 
|  | default: | 
|  | return BOOT_MEM_RESERVED; | 
|  | } | 
|  | } | 
|  |  | 
|  | void __init prom_meminit(void) | 
|  | { | 
|  | struct prom_pmemblock *p; | 
|  |  | 
|  | p = prom_getmdesc(); | 
|  |  | 
|  | while (p->size) { | 
|  | long type; | 
|  | unsigned long base, size; | 
|  |  | 
|  | type = prom_memtype_classify (p->type); | 
|  | base = p->base; | 
|  | size = p->size; | 
|  |  | 
|  | add_memory_region(base, size, type); | 
|  | p++; | 
|  | } | 
|  | } | 
|  |  | 
|  | void __init prom_free_prom_memory(void) | 
|  | { | 
|  | int i; | 
|  | unsigned long addr; | 
|  |  | 
|  | for (i = 0; i < boot_mem_map.nr_map; i++) { | 
|  | if (boot_mem_map.map[i].type != BOOT_MEM_ROM_DATA) | 
|  | continue; | 
|  |  | 
|  | addr = boot_mem_map.map[i].addr; | 
|  | free_init_pages("prom memory", | 
|  | addr, addr + boot_mem_map.map[i].size); | 
|  | } | 
|  | } |
